I agree with you and a lot of the things people who are responding are saying but the one thing that keeps popping in my head is that Apple who is disrupting in this case isn't exactly the lightweight scrappy contender as put forth in the parables and anecdotes. If the hypothesis is true for Intel why is giant Apple not suffering from the same mercenary middle management / toxic political BS?

Apple is very differently organised from most big corporations, it has whats known as a functional organisational structure. Marketing, operations, software engineering, hardware engineering, etc.

Most corporations are organised around product groups, but what happens when the mobile products group comes up with a new device and wants to sell it to corporate clients? The enterprise products division might not like that. Imagine if Apple had a Mac division selling laptops, they might not have been happy about the Phone division coming out with the iPad and keyboard cases.

> let us note that Christensen himself assessed the iphone as non-disruptive.

Which I suppose it is, but I think it's important to ask: if Apple didn't introduce a disruptive technology, why were they able to do what Nokia didn't?

Its hard to deny how the iPhone represented a power shift away from carriers. It's easy to forget but a decade ago you had to pay carriers for the privilege of changing your ringtone. They had their fingers in every pie, in exchange for access to the market the carriers more or less controlled. Hell, you often couldn't even bring your phone if you switched carriers.

Nokia was too busy pleasing their customers: the big cellular providers who ordered most of their phones. And the status quo heavily favored them -- the top selling phone of all time is still a Nokia phone from 2004. They didn't really have any idea how to market direct to consumer and their brand had no particular meaning -- they made as many SKUs as carriers wanted. Since they were in a clearly dominant position, they had no need to arm twist the weakest player to break into the market, and a lot to lose if they played hardball.

Clay's right that it's not a traditional "cheap tech finds a new purpose undermining more expensive status quo" but it definitely rhymes -- all the incentives are the same and adequately explains why Nokia fell apart.

As someone who worked on Intel's phone chip: we definitely didn't win it. We fucked it up twelve ways to Sunday. Why: giant egos. There were turf wars between Austin, Santa Clara and Israel over who would design it, and the team that won out had long since lost its best principle engineers and had no clue how to spin the architecture to meet the design win. Otellini's hindsight hedge is pure spin: we knew the landing…

But whatever real innovation underlay Xeon Phi/KNx was performed two decades ago. Current Intel is only capable of SKUsmanship - minutely partitioning function for projected max margins. Edit: Also too, remember that KNx was really an attempt to salvage Intel's failed Larrabee GPU effort.

> Also too, remember that KNx was really an attempt to salvage Intel's failed Larrabee GPU effort. I do, and I don't think you know that the first "Knights" project was simply a rename of Larrabee. Same exact product. It was called Knights ... Landing I think? Then it became Xeon Phi.

Knights Ferry was the 1st. Unclear about the actual diffs between it and Larrabee silicon. I do know the 1st boards still had a video out port but it was disconnected.

I'm still waiting for my M1 to show up but from studying the details that other people have commented on, it's clear that Apple is slathering on the microarchitectural resources that both Intel and AMD are stingy with. Their core has a gigantic L1 instruction cache, rather a lot of L1 TLB entries (4x more than Intel), large(r) pages by default, and many other aspects. L1 TLB entries in particular are a well-known pro…

Interesting that you mention page size, IMHO 4k was small even 10 years ago. Though of course the next bump is 4M which I think might be too big for most apps Apparently ARM supports 4KB, 64KB and 1MB (I just googled that) Also maybe all the x86 crud might be finally taking its toll (and not just the ISA but all the cruft that got on top of it for 40yrs+ like legacy buses and functionalities, ACPI, or even the overen…

There’s nothing wrong with ACPI - in fact it’s what’s going to enable ARM in the server space. Without something like ACPI, you need customized kernels and other crap to control system devices. ACPI is actually quite nice. And it replaced something (APM) that really was legacy cruft (dropping into real mode for power management?!! Ugh!)
